Application August 8, 1936, Serial No. 93,951 4 (Cl. 12 8"7 8 This invention relates to surgical appliances, and the object of the invention is to provide an appliance of novel and advantageous construction which is well adapted for use in the treat- .ment of disorders of the spine and of other bony and muscular parts and associated nerves of the human body. which are located in the region of or are affected by the condition of the spine.
Among the many such disorders which may be 1p. treated by the use of the appliance are fractured vertebrae, dislocated vertebrae, spinal curvature, tuberculosis of the vertebrae and associated parts, fracture of the sternum and fracture of the pelvis.

The members 22 and 23, 23.are.made of suitable sheet metal; such for example as phosphorbronze, which is sufliciently resilient to return to its normal .or:set condition after it has been flexed andreleased during the use. of the-applieance, and which iSJbendabI'e beyond. its elastic limit to change the norm-a1 shape or configuration thereof withoutdestroying its resilient character, for purposes presently appearing.
When the appliance is in service, the body belt 2' is placed around the bodyiiof the patient or user, as previously explainedJThis places the end portions otthe hem30.?and,the end portions of the horizontal metal member-22 therein di-' rectly over the hips of patient. The hooks 8 are connected to the loops |-|1of the, fastening devices I3 at the front of the belt, and the devices l3 are properly adjusted to retain the body of the belt around the body of the patient with suitable tightness for comfortand the proper functioning of the parts of 'the'appliancef I After the application of the main body of the belt, 2 to the patient, as just describedftheside strap 3'4'is engaged' with the buckle 36,01 the side strap. 33, and .the",'side' straps are'tigh'tened at the front of the gappli'ance in a mannerito' flex the horizontal metal member 22 around the back and sides of the-patient and holdit firmly in place." This firm holding 'inplace of the member 22 causes it to support '-arid-retain the vertical metal members 23, 23 i'ri'-"thei 1"-'-pr'oper SDI position 'direc'tlyback of? the patient's spin'al column on the respective sides of the vertical center thereof.
Following the application of the body belt 2 to the patient and the tightening of the side straps 33 and 34, the ends of the pressure belt 31 are connected by means of the buckle 38 at the front of the appliance and tightened sufficiently to produce the desired inward pressure against the resilient, vertical members 23, 23 between and spaced from the upper and lower ends thereof for the proper functioning of the members.
The vertical members 23, 23 may be bent into any desired shape or configuration suitable for producing pressure or pressures in the region or regions of the spine where pressure is desired for the correction of the dislocated vertebrae or the proper support of fractured vertebrae or for the treatment of any other disorder. The members 23, 23 may be shaped to properly support the spinal column as a whole, while the members and the other parts of the appliance give proper support to adjacent other parts of the patients body for the treatment of disorders thereof.
The vertical members 23, 23 maybe bowed more or less as shown in Figs. 4 and 6 of the drawings, and, when so bowed the end portions of the members and the enlarged end portions 44, 44 of the pad 43, inwardly thereof, are not only pressed inwardly but they are also forced apart when the pressure belt 31 is tightened, thereby causing a spreading or separation of the vertebrae when such treatment is desired.
The vertical members 23, 23 may be bent to produce pressure and to preserve the same configuration or symmetry thereof when it is desired to localize pressure on each side of a part of the spinal column, or they may be independently bent into different forms to produce pressure at but one side of the spinal column or on opposite sides thereof at different levels, in accordance with the desired treatment.
The pad 43, crossing the space between the members 23, 23 serves to produce pressure against the vertebrae between the members, in accordance with the configuration of the members. Thus it will be seen that many different pressures may be produced at various places on the patients body for the correction and treatment of various disorders.
